  28. #include "precompiled.h"
  29. #include "../../Include/RmlUi/Core/StyleSheetSpecification.h"
  30. #include "../../Include/RmlUi/Core/PropertyIdSet.h"
  31. #include "PropertyParserNumber.h"
  32. #include "PropertyParserAnimation.h"
  33. #include "PropertyParserColour.h"
  34. #include "PropertyParserKeyword.h"
  35. #include "PropertyParserString.h"
  36. #include "PropertyParserTransform.h"
  37. #include "PropertyShorthandDefinition.h"
  38. #include "IdNameMap.h"
  39. namespace Rml {
  40. namespace Core {
  41. static StyleSheetSpecification* instance = nullptr;
  42. StyleSheetSpecification::StyleSheetSpecification() :
  43. // Reserve space for all defined ids and some more for custom properties
  44. properties(2 * (size_t)PropertyId::NumDefinedIds, 2 * (size_t)ShorthandId::NumDefinedIds)
  45. {
  46. RMLUI_ASSERT(instance == nullptr);
  47. instance = this;
  48. }
  49. StyleSheetSpecification::~StyleSheetSpecification()
  50. {
  51. RMLUI_ASSERT(instance == this);
  52. instance = nullptr;
  53. }
  54. PropertyDefinition& StyleSheetSpecification::RegisterProperty(PropertyId id, const String& property_name, const String& default_value, bool inherited, bool forces_layout)
  55. {
  56. return properties.RegisterProperty(property_name, default_value, inherited, forces_layout, id);
  57. }
  58. ShorthandId StyleSheetSpecification::RegisterShorthand(ShorthandId id, const String& shorthand_name, const String& property_names, ShorthandType type)
  59. {
  60. return properties.RegisterShorthand(shorthand_name, property_names, type, id);
  61. }
  62. bool StyleSheetSpecification::Initialise()
  63. {
  64. if (instance == nullptr)
  65. {
  66. new StyleSheetSpecification();
  67. instance->RegisterDefaultParsers();
  68. instance->RegisterDefaultProperties();
  69. }
  70. return true;
  71. }
  72. void StyleSheetSpecification::Shutdown()
  73. {
  74. if (instance != nullptr)
  75. {
  76. for (ParserMap::iterator iterator = instance->parsers.begin(); iterator != instance->parsers.end(); ++iterator)
  77. (*iterator).second->Release();
  78. delete instance;
  79. }
  80. }
  81. // Registers a parser for use in property definitions.
  82. bool StyleSheetSpecification::RegisterParser(const String& parser_name, PropertyParser* parser)
  83. {
  84. ParserMap::iterator iterator = instance->parsers.find(parser_name);
  85. if (iterator != instance->parsers.end())
  86. (*iterator).second->Release();
  87. instance->parsers[parser_name] = parser;
  88. return true;
  89. }
  90. // Returns the parser registered with a specific name.
  91. PropertyParser* StyleSheetSpecification::GetParser(const String& parser_name)
  92. {
  93. ParserMap::iterator iterator = instance->parsers.find(parser_name);
  94. if (iterator == instance->parsers.end())
  95. return nullptr;
  96. return (*iterator).second;
  97. }
  98. // Registers a property with a new definition.
  99. PropertyDefinition& StyleSheetSpecification::RegisterProperty(const String& property_name, const String& default_value, bool inherited, bool forces_layout)
  100. {
  101. RMLUI_ASSERTMSG((size_t)instance->properties.property_map->GetId(property_name) < (size_t)PropertyId::FirstCustomId, "Custom property name matches an internal property, please make a unique name for the given property.");
  102. return instance->RegisterProperty(PropertyId::Invalid, property_name, default_value, inherited, forces_layout);
  103. }
  104. // Returns a property definition.
  105. const PropertyDefinition* StyleSheetSpecification::GetProperty(const String& property_name)
  106. {
  107. return instance->properties.GetProperty(property_name);
  108. }
  109. const PropertyDefinition* StyleSheetSpecification::GetProperty(PropertyId id)
  110. {
  111. return instance->properties.GetProperty(id);
  112. }
  113. // Fetches a list of the names of all registered property definitions.
  114. const PropertyIdSet& StyleSheetSpecification::GetRegisteredProperties()
  115. {
  116. return instance->properties.GetRegisteredProperties();
  117. }
  118. const PropertyIdSet & StyleSheetSpecification::GetRegisteredInheritedProperties()
  119. {
  120. return instance->properties.GetRegisteredInheritedProperties();
  121. }
  122. // Registers a shorthand property definition.
  123. ShorthandId StyleSheetSpecification::RegisterShorthand(const String& shorthand_name, const String& property_names, ShorthandType type)
  124. {
  125. RMLUI_ASSERTMSG(instance->properties.property_map->GetId(shorthand_name) == PropertyId::Invalid, "Custom shorthand name matches a property name, please make a unique name.");
  126. RMLUI_ASSERTMSG((size_t)instance->properties.shorthand_map->GetId(shorthand_name) < (size_t)ShorthandId::FirstCustomId, "Custom shorthand name matches an internal shorthand, please make a unique name for the given shorthand property.");
  127. return instance->properties.RegisterShorthand(shorthand_name, property_names, type);
  128. }
  129. // Returns a shorthand definition.
  130. const ShorthandDefinition* StyleSheetSpecification::GetShorthand(const String& shorthand_name)
  131. {
  132. return instance->properties.GetShorthand(shorthand_name);
  133. }
  134. const ShorthandDefinition* StyleSheetSpecification::GetShorthand(ShorthandId id)
  135. {
  136. return instance->properties.GetShorthand(id);
  137. }
  138. // Parses a property declaration, setting any parsed and validated properties on the given dictionary.
  139. bool StyleSheetSpecification::ParsePropertyDeclaration(PropertyDictionary& dictionary, const String& property_name, const String& property_value, const String& source_file, int source_line_number)
  140. {
  141. return instance->properties.ParsePropertyDeclaration(dictionary, property_name, property_value, source_file, source_line_number);
  142. }
  143. PropertyId StyleSheetSpecification::GetPropertyId(const String& property_name)
  144. {
  145. return instance->properties.property_map->GetId(property_name);
  146. }
  147. ShorthandId StyleSheetSpecification::GetShorthandId(const String& shorthand_name)
  148. {
  149. return instance->properties.shorthand_map->GetId(shorthand_name);
  150. }
  151. const String& StyleSheetSpecification::GetPropertyName(PropertyId id)
  152. {
  153. return instance->properties.property_map->GetName(id);
  154. }
  155. const String& StyleSheetSpecification::GetShorthandName(ShorthandId id)
  156. {
  157. return instance->properties.shorthand_map->GetName(id);
  158. }
  159. PropertyIdSet StyleSheetSpecification::GetShorthandUnderlyingProperties(ShorthandId id)
  160. {
  161. PropertyIdSet result;
  162. const ShorthandDefinition* shorthand = instance->properties.GetShorthand(id);
  163. if (!shorthand)
  164. return result;
  165. for (auto& item : shorthand->items)
  166. {
  167. if (item.type == ShorthandItemType::Property)
  168. {
  169. result.Insert(item.property_id);
  170. }
  171. else if (item.type == ShorthandItemType::Shorthand)
  172. {
  173. // When we have a shorthand pointing to another shorthands, call us recursively. Add the union of the previous result and new properties.
  174. result |= GetShorthandUnderlyingProperties(item.shorthand_id);
  175. }
  176. }
  177. return result;
  178. }
  179. const PropertySpecification& StyleSheetSpecification::GetPropertySpecification()
  180. {
  181. return instance->properties;
  182. }
  183. // Registers RmlUi's default parsers.
  184. void StyleSheetSpecification::RegisterDefaultParsers()
  185. {
  186. RegisterParser("number", new PropertyParserNumber(Property::NUMBER));
  187. RegisterParser("length", new PropertyParserNumber(Property::LENGTH, Property::PX));
  188. RegisterParser("length_percent", new PropertyParserNumber(Property::LENGTH_PERCENT, Property::PX));
  189. RegisterParser("number_length_percent", new PropertyParserNumber(Property::NUMBER_LENGTH_PERCENT, Property::PX));
  190. RegisterParser("angle", new PropertyParserNumber(Property::ANGLE, Property::RAD));
  191. RegisterParser("keyword", new PropertyParserKeyword());
  192. RegisterParser("string", new PropertyParserString());
  193. RegisterParser(ANIMATION, new PropertyParserAnimation(PropertyParserAnimation::ANIMATION_PARSER));
  194. RegisterParser(TRANSITION, new PropertyParserAnimation(PropertyParserAnimation::TRANSITION_PARSER));
  195. RegisterParser(COLOR, new PropertyParserColour());
  196. RegisterParser(TRANSFORM, new PropertyParserTransform());
  197. }
  198. // Registers RmlUi's default style properties.
  199. void StyleSheetSpecification::RegisterDefaultProperties()
  200. {
  201. // Style property specifications (ala RCSS).
  202. RegisterProperty(PropertyId::MarginTop, MARGIN_TOP, "0px", false, true)
  203. .AddParser("keyword", "auto")
  204. .AddParser("length_percent").SetRelativeTarget(RelativeTarget::ContainingBlockWidth);
  205. RegisterProperty(PropertyId::MarginRight, MARGIN_RIGHT, "0px", false, true)
  206. .AddParser("keyword", "auto")
  207. .AddParser("length_percent").SetRelativeTarget(RelativeTarget::ContainingBlockWidth);
  208. RegisterProperty(PropertyId::MarginBottom, MARGIN_BOTTOM, "0px", false, true)
  209. .AddParser("keyword", "auto")
  210. .AddParser("length_percent").SetRelativeTarget(RelativeTarget::ContainingBlockWidth);
  211. RegisterProperty(PropertyId::MarginLeft, MARGIN_LEFT, "0px", false, true)
  212. .AddParser("keyword", "auto")
  213. .AddParser("length_percent").SetRelativeTarget(RelativeTarget::ContainingBlockWidth);
  214. RegisterShorthand(ShorthandId::Margin, MARGIN, "margin-top, margin-right, margin-bottom, margin-left", ShorthandType::Box);
  215. RegisterProperty(PropertyId::PaddingTop, PADDING_TOP, "0px", false, true).AddParser("length_percent").SetRelativeTarget(RelativeTarget::ContainingBlockWidth);
  216. RegisterProperty(PropertyId::PaddingRight, PADDING_RIGHT, "0px", false, true).AddParser("length_percent").SetRelativeTarget(RelativeTarget::ContainingBlockWidth);
  217. RegisterProperty(PropertyId::PaddingBottom, PADDING_BOTTOM, "0px", false, true).AddParser("length_percent").SetRelativeTarget(RelativeTarget::ContainingBlockWidth);
  218. RegisterProperty(PropertyId::PaddingLeft, PADDING_LEFT, "0px", false, true).AddParser("length_percent").SetRelativeTarget(RelativeTarget::ContainingBlockWidth);
  219. RegisterShorthand(ShorthandId::Padding, PADDING, "padding-top, padding-right, padding-bottom, padding-left", ShorthandType::Box);
  220. RegisterProperty(PropertyId::BorderTopWidth, BORDER_TOP_WIDTH, "0px", false, true).AddParser("length");
  221. RegisterProperty(PropertyId::BorderRightWidth, BORDER_RIGHT_WIDTH, "0px", false, true).AddParser("length");
  222. RegisterProperty(PropertyId::BorderBottomWidth, BORDER_BOTTOM_WIDTH, "0px", false, true).AddParser("length");
  223. RegisterProperty(PropertyId::BorderLeftWidth, BORDER_LEFT_WIDTH, "0px", false, true).AddParser("length");
  224. RegisterShorthand(ShorthandId::BorderWidth, BORDER_WIDTH, "border-top-width, border-right-width, border-bottom-width, border-left-width", ShorthandType::Box);
  225. RegisterProperty(PropertyId::BorderTopColor, BORDER_TOP_COLOR, "black", false, false).AddParser(COLOR);
  226. RegisterProperty(PropertyId::BorderRightColor, BORDER_RIGHT_COLOR, "black", false, false).AddParser(COLOR);
  227. RegisterProperty(PropertyId::BorderBottomColor, BORDER_BOTTOM_COLOR, "black", false, false).AddParser(COLOR);
  228. RegisterProperty(PropertyId::BorderLeftColor, BORDER_LEFT_COLOR, "black", false, false).AddParser(COLOR);
  229. RegisterShorthand(ShorthandId::BorderColor, BORDER_COLOR, "border-top-color, border-right-color, border-bottom-color, border-left-color", ShorthandType::Box);
  230. RegisterShorthand(ShorthandId::BorderTop, BORDER_TOP, "border-top-width, border-top-color", ShorthandType::FallThrough);
  231. RegisterShorthand(ShorthandId::BorderRight, BORDER_RIGHT, "border-right-width, border-right-color", ShorthandType::FallThrough);
  232. RegisterShorthand(ShorthandId::BorderBottom, BORDER_BOTTOM, "border-bottom-width, border-bottom-color", ShorthandType::FallThrough);
  233. RegisterShorthand(ShorthandId::BorderLeft, BORDER_LEFT, "border-left-width, border-left-color", ShorthandType::FallThrough);
  234. RegisterShorthand(ShorthandId::Border, BORDER, "border-top, border-right, border-bottom, border-left", ShorthandType::Recursive);
  235. RegisterProperty(PropertyId::Display, DISPLAY, "inline", false, true).AddParser("keyword", "none, block, inline, inline-block");
  236. RegisterProperty(PropertyId::Position, POSITION, "static", false, true).AddParser("keyword", "static, relative, absolute, fixed");
  237. RegisterProperty(PropertyId::Top, TOP, "auto", false, false)
  238. .AddParser("keyword", "auto")
  239. .AddParser("length_percent").SetRelativeTarget(RelativeTarget::ContainingBlockHeight);
  240. RegisterProperty(PropertyId::Right, RIGHT, "auto", false, false)
  241. .AddParser("keyword", "auto")
  242. .AddParser("length_percent").SetRelativeTarget(RelativeTarget::ContainingBlockWidth);
  243. RegisterProperty(PropertyId::Bottom, BOTTOM, "auto", false, false)
  244. .AddParser("keyword", "auto")
  245. .AddParser("length_percent").SetRelativeTarget(RelativeTarget::ContainingBlockHeight);
  246. RegisterProperty(PropertyId::Left, LEFT, "auto", false, false)
  247. .AddParser("keyword", "auto")
  248. .AddParser("length_percent").SetRelativeTarget(RelativeTarget::ContainingBlockWidth);
  249. RegisterProperty(PropertyId::Float, FLOAT, "none", false, true).AddParser("keyword", "none, left, right");
  250. RegisterProperty(PropertyId::Clear, CLEAR, "none", false, true).AddParser("keyword", "none, left, right, both");
  251. RegisterProperty(PropertyId::ZIndex, Z_INDEX, "auto", false, false)
  252. .AddParser("keyword", "auto")
  253. .AddParser("number");
  254. RegisterProperty(PropertyId::Width, WIDTH, "auto", false, true)
  255. .AddParser("keyword", "auto")
  256. .AddParser("length_percent").SetRelativeTarget(RelativeTarget::ContainingBlockWidth);
  257. RegisterProperty(PropertyId::MinWidth, MIN_WIDTH, "0px", false, true).AddParser("length_percent").SetRelativeTarget(RelativeTarget::ContainingBlockWidth);
  258. RegisterProperty(PropertyId::MaxWidth, MAX_WIDTH, "-1px", false, true).AddParser("length_percent").SetRelativeTarget(RelativeTarget::ContainingBlockWidth);
  259. RegisterProperty(PropertyId::Height, HEIGHT, "auto", false, true)
  260. .AddParser("keyword", "auto")
  261. .AddParser("length_percent").SetRelativeTarget(RelativeTarget::ContainingBlockHeight);
  262. RegisterProperty(PropertyId::MinHeight, MIN_HEIGHT, "0px", false, true).AddParser("length_percent").SetRelativeTarget(RelativeTarget::ContainingBlockHeight);
  263. RegisterProperty(PropertyId::MaxHeight, MAX_HEIGHT, "-1px", false, true).AddParser("length_percent").SetRelativeTarget(RelativeTarget::ContainingBlockHeight);
  264. RegisterProperty(PropertyId::LineHeight, LINE_HEIGHT, "1.2", true, true).AddParser("number_length_percent").SetRelativeTarget(RelativeTarget::FontSize);
  265. RegisterProperty(PropertyId::VerticalAlign, VERTICAL_ALIGN, "baseline", false, true)
  266. .AddParser("keyword", "baseline, middle, sub, super, text-top, text-bottom, top, bottom")
  267. .AddParser("length_percent").SetRelativeTarget(RelativeTarget::LineHeight);
  268. RegisterProperty(PropertyId::OverflowX, OVERFLOW_X, "visible", false, true).AddParser("keyword", "visible, hidden, auto, scroll");
  269. RegisterProperty(PropertyId::OverflowY, OVERFLOW_Y, "visible", false, true).AddParser("keyword", "visible, hidden, auto, scroll");
  270. RegisterShorthand(ShorthandId::Overflow, "overflow", "overflow-x, overflow-y", ShorthandType::Replicate);
  271. RegisterProperty(PropertyId::Clip, CLIP, "auto", true, false).AddParser("keyword", "auto, none").AddParser("number");
  272. RegisterProperty(PropertyId::Visibility, VISIBILITY, "visible", false, false).AddParser("keyword", "visible, hidden");
  273. // Need some work on this if we are to include images.
  274. RegisterProperty(PropertyId::BackgroundColor, BACKGROUND_COLOR, "transparent", false, false).AddParser(COLOR);
  275. RegisterShorthand(ShorthandId::Background, BACKGROUND, BACKGROUND_COLOR, ShorthandType::FallThrough);
  276. RegisterProperty(PropertyId::Color, COLOR, "white", true, false).AddParser(COLOR);
  277. RegisterProperty(PropertyId::ImageColor, IMAGE_COLOR, "white", false, false).AddParser(COLOR);
  278. RegisterProperty(PropertyId::Opacity, OPACITY, "1", true, false).AddParser("number");
  279. RegisterProperty(PropertyId::FontFamily, FONT_FAMILY, "", true, true).AddParser("string");
  280. RegisterProperty(PropertyId::FontCharset, FONT_CHARSET, "U+0020-007E", true, false).AddParser("string");
  281. RegisterProperty(PropertyId::FontStyle, FONT_STYLE, "normal", true, true).AddParser("keyword", "normal, italic");
  282. RegisterProperty(PropertyId::FontWeight, FONT_WEIGHT, "normal", true, true).AddParser("keyword", "normal, bold");
  283. RegisterProperty(PropertyId::FontSize, FONT_SIZE, "12px", true, true).AddParser("length").AddParser("length_percent").SetRelativeTarget(RelativeTarget::ParentFontSize);
  284. RegisterShorthand(ShorthandId::Font, FONT, "font-style, font-weight, font-size, font-family, font-charset", ShorthandType::FallThrough);
  285. RegisterProperty(PropertyId::TextAlign, TEXT_ALIGN, LEFT, true, true).AddParser("keyword", "left, right, center, justify");
  286. RegisterProperty(PropertyId::TextDecoration, TEXT_DECORATION, "none", true, false).AddParser("keyword", "none, underline"/*"none, underline, overline, line-through"*/);
  287. RegisterProperty(PropertyId::TextTransform, TEXT_TRANSFORM, "none", true, true).AddParser("keyword", "none, capitalize, uppercase, lowercase");
  288. RegisterProperty(PropertyId::WhiteSpace, WHITE_SPACE, "normal", true, true).AddParser("keyword", "normal, pre, nowrap, pre-wrap, pre-line");
  289. RegisterProperty(PropertyId::Cursor, CURSOR, "", true, false).AddParser("string");
  290. // Functional property specifications.
  291. RegisterProperty(PropertyId::Drag, DRAG, "none", false, false).AddParser("keyword", "none, drag, drag-drop, block, clone");
  292. RegisterProperty(PropertyId::TabIndex, TAB_INDEX, "none", false, false).AddParser("keyword", "none, auto");
  293. RegisterProperty(PropertyId::Focus, FOCUS, "auto", true, false).AddParser("keyword", "none, auto");
  294. RegisterProperty(PropertyId::ScrollbarMargin, SCROLLBAR_MARGIN, "0", false, false).AddParser("length");
  295. RegisterProperty(PropertyId::PointerEvents, POINTER_EVENTS, "auto", true, false).AddParser("keyword", "none, auto");
  296. // Perspective and Transform specifications
  297. RegisterProperty(PropertyId::Perspective, PERSPECTIVE, "none", false, false).AddParser("keyword", "none").AddParser("length");
  298. RegisterProperty(PropertyId::PerspectiveOriginX, PERSPECTIVE_ORIGIN_X, "50%", false, false).AddParser("keyword", "left, center, right").AddParser("length_percent");
  299. RegisterProperty(PropertyId::PerspectiveOriginY, PERSPECTIVE_ORIGIN_Y, "50%", false, false).AddParser("keyword", "top, center, bottom").AddParser("length_percent");
  300. RegisterShorthand(ShorthandId::PerspectiveOrigin, PERSPECTIVE_ORIGIN, "perspective-origin-x, perspective-origin-y", ShorthandType::FallThrough);
  301. RegisterProperty(PropertyId::Transform, TRANSFORM, "none", false, false).AddParser(TRANSFORM);
  302. RegisterProperty(PropertyId::TransformOriginX, TRANSFORM_ORIGIN_X, "50%", false, false).AddParser("keyword", "left, center, right").AddParser("length_percent");
  303. RegisterProperty(PropertyId::TransformOriginY, TRANSFORM_ORIGIN_Y, "50%", false, false).AddParser("keyword", "top, center, bottom").AddParser("length_percent");
  304. RegisterProperty(PropertyId::TransformOriginZ, TRANSFORM_ORIGIN_Z, "0", false, false).AddParser("length");
  305. RegisterShorthand(ShorthandId::TransformOrigin, TRANSFORM_ORIGIN, "transform-origin-x, transform-origin-y, transform-origin-z", ShorthandType::FallThrough);
  306. RegisterProperty(PropertyId::Transition, TRANSITION, "none", false, false).AddParser(TRANSITION);
  307. RegisterProperty(PropertyId::Animation, ANIMATION, "none", false, false).AddParser(ANIMATION);
  308. RegisterProperty(PropertyId::Decorator, "decorator", "", false, false).AddParser("string");
  309. RegisterProperty(PropertyId::FontEffect, "font-effect", "", true, false).AddParser("string");
  310. instance->properties.property_map->AssertAllInserted(PropertyId::NumDefinedIds);
  311. instance->properties.shorthand_map->AssertAllInserted(ShorthandId::NumDefinedIds);
  312. }
  313. }
  314. }
